One of the favorite shows when I was a child when television was new was 77 Sunset Strip. It lasted 1958-1964 of the main characters of this show have been popular private detective Stu Bailey played by Efrem Zimbalist Jr.and Jeff Spencer played by Roger Smith. Kookie, another character, a valet parking always combed his hair coiffed Elvis-cur that his behavior signature. It bothered me when the girls all dress screening, when he did. Kookie was played by Edd Byrnes His character's name curiously spelled (yes, it was spelled with a "K") means his fortune was no less assured by a huge female fan club. More work with him was Jacqueline Beer, who had been Miss France 1954, so it does him no harm.
